အကောင်းဆုံးအဖြေ- Android တွင် XML ဖိုင်အသုံးပြုမှုကား အဘယ်နည်း။

xml): ဤ xml ကိုကျွန်ုပ်တို့၏အပလီကေးရှင်း၏အစိတ်အပိုင်းအားလုံးကိုသတ်မှတ်ရန်အသုံးပြုသည်။ ၎င်းတွင် ကျွန်ုပ်တို့၏ အပလီကေးရှင်း ပက်ကေ့ချ်များ၏ အမည်များ၊ ကျွန်ုပ်တို့၏ လုပ်ဆောင်ချက်များ၊ လက်ခံသူများ၊ ဝန်ဆောင်မှုများနှင့် ကျွန်ုပ်တို့၏ လျှောက်လွှာတွင် လိုအပ်သော ခွင့်ပြုချက်များ ပါဝင်သည်။ ဥပမာ- ကျွန်ုပ်တို့၏အက်ပ်တွင် အင်တာနက်အသုံးပြုရန် လိုအပ်သည်ဆိုပါစို့၊ ထို့နောက် ဤဖိုင်တွင် အင်တာနက်ခွင့်ပြုချက်ကို သတ်မှတ်ရန် လိုအပ်သည်။

Android တွင် XML ကို ဘာအတွက်အသုံးပြုသနည်း။

eXtensible Markup Language (သို့) XML- အင်တာနက်အခြေခံ အပလီကေးရှင်းများတွင် ဒေတာကို ကုဒ်လုပ်ရန် စံနည်းလမ်းတစ်ခုအဖြစ် ဖန်တီးထားသော markup ဘာသာစကား။ Android အပလီကေးရှင်းများသည် layout ဖိုင်များဖန်တီးရန် XML ကိုအသုံးပြုသည်။ HTML နှင့်မတူဘဲ၊ XML သည် စာလုံးအကြီးအသေးသာဖြစ်ပြီး တဂ်တစ်ခုစီကို ပိတ်ရန် လိုအပ်ပြီး နေရာလွတ်များကို ထိန်းသိမ်းထားသည်။

Android အတွက် XML လိုအပ်ပါသလား။

Java နှင့် XML ကိုသင်လေ့လာပြီးသည်နှင့် (XML သည်အသုံးပြုရန်အလွန်လွယ်ကူသည်၊ နှင့်သင် Java ကဲ့သို့သင်ကြိုတင်လေ့လာခြင်းထက်သင်၏အက်ပ်ကိုပရိုဂရမ်ပြုလုပ်သည့်ဘာသာစကားကိုလေ့လာသင့်သည်)၊ သင်သည်ဤနှစ်ခုကို Android ကိုအသုံးပြု၍ ချိတ်ဆက်နည်းကိုလေ့လာရန်လိုအပ်သည်။ အခြေခံမူများ။

XML ဖိုင်များကို ဘာအတွက် အသုံးပြုကြသနည်း။

XML ဖိုင်သည် တိုးချဲ့နိုင်သော markup ဘာသာစကားဖိုင်တစ်ခုဖြစ်ပြီး ၎င်းကို သိုလှောင်မှုနှင့် ပို့ဆောင်မှုအတွက် ဒေတာကို တည်ဆောက်ရန် အသုံးပြုပါသည်။ XML ဖိုင်တွင် တဂ်များနှင့် စာသား နှစ်မျိုးလုံး ရှိပါသည်။ tags များသည် data ကိုတည်ဆောက်ပုံအားပေးသည်။ သင်သိမ်းဆည်းလိုသော ဖိုင်ရှိ စာသားသည် တိကျသော syntax လမ်းညွှန်ချက်များကို လိုက်နာသည့် ဤတဂ်များဖြင့် ဝိုင်းရံထားသည်။

Android တွင် အဓိက XML ဆိုသည်မှာ အဘယ်နည်း။

main.xml သည် xml အပြင်အဆင်ကို သိမ်းဆည်းရန် သင့်ပရောဂျက်တွင်ပါရှိသော layout ဖိုင်တစ်ခုမျှသာဖြစ်သည်… အကယ်၍ သင်သည် ecipse ကိုအသုံးပြုနေပါက ၎င်းသည် အလိုအလျောက်ထုတ်ပေးလိမ့်မည် (နှင့် eclipse သည် activity_youractivityname.xml ကဲ့သို့ ၎င်း၏အမည်ကို ပြုပြင်ပေးလိမ့်မည်) အဆင့် 1>ပထမဦးစွာ android ဖန်တီးရန် ပညာရှိများကို လေ့လာကြည့်ပါ ပရောဂျက် File->New->Android အပလီကေးရှင်းပရောဂျက်။

Android တွင် XML ကို မည်သို့လေ့လာနိုင်မည်နည်း။

စာရွက်စာတမ်းများတွင် သင်လိုအပ်နိုင်သည့် xml အရည်အချင်းများကို သင်ရှာတွေ့နိုင်ပြီး၊ https://developer.android.com/reference/android/widget/TextView.html ကဲ့သို့သော အတန်းတစ်ခုကို ရှာဖွေနိုင်ပြီး အောက်ဘက်အနည်းငယ်တွင် xml ရည်ညွှန်းချက်များကို လင့်ခ်တစ်ခုရှိပါသည် သင်သုံးနိုင်သည်။

XML အပြည့်အစုံဆိုသည်မှာ အဘယ်နည်း။

XML၊ အပြည့်အ၀ တိုးချဲ့နိုင်သော markup language၊ အချို့သော World Wide ဝဘ်စာမျက်နှာများအတွက် အသုံးပြုသည့် စာရွက်စာတမ်းဖော်မတ်ဘာသာစကား။ ဝက်ဘ်စာမျက်နှာများအတွက် အခြေခံဖော်မတ်ဖြစ်သော HTML (စာသားပါသော အမှတ်အသားဘာသာစကား) သည် 1990 ခုနှစ်များတွင် စတင်တီထွင်ခဲ့ခြင်းဖြစ်ပြီး စာသားဒြပ်စင်အသစ်များ၏ အဓိပ္ပါယ်ဖွင့်ဆိုချက်ကို ခွင့်မပြုသောကြောင့်၊ ဆိုလိုသည်မှာ၊ တိုးချဲ့၍မရပါ။

Android အပလီကေးရှင်း ဖွံ့ဖြိုးတိုးတက်ရေး လွယ်ကူပါသလား။

အရင်က တစ်ခါမှ မလုပ်ဖူးရင် အက်ပ်တစ်ခုကို တည်ဆောက်ရတာ မလွယ်ပေမယ့် တစ်နေရာရာမှာ စတင်ရပါမယ်။ ကမ္ဘာတစ်ဝှမ်းရှိ Android အသုံးပြုသူမည်မျှရှိသောကြောင့် Android ပလပ်ဖောင်းပေါ်တွင် မည်သို့ဖွံ့ဖြိုးတိုးတက်ရမည်ကို လေ့လာရန် အရေးကြီးပါသည်။ သေးသေးလေးမှ စပြီး သေချာလုပ်ပါ။ စက်ပေါ်တွင် ကြိုတင်ထည့်သွင်းထားသည့် အင်္ဂါရပ်များကို လွှမ်းခြုံထားသည့် အက်ပ်များကို တည်ဆောက်ပါ။

XML ကို လေ့လာရခက်ပါသလား။

သတင်းကောင်းကတော့ HTML ရဲ့ ကန့်သတ်ချက်တော်တော်များများကို Extensible Markup Language ဖြစ်တဲ့ XML မှာ ကျော်ဖြတ်ပြီးပါပြီ။ XML သည် HTML ကို နားလည်သူတိုင်းအတွက် လွယ်ကူစွာ နားလည်နိုင်သော်လည်း ၎င်းသည် ပိုမိုအားကောင်းသည်။ markup language တစ်ခုထက်မက၊ XML သည် သတ္တုဘာသာစကားဖြစ်သည် — markup language အသစ်များကို သတ်မှတ်ရန် အသုံးပြုသော ဘာသာစကားတစ်ခုဖြစ်သည်။

XML ကို လေ့လာရန် လိုအပ်ပါသလား။

3 အဖြေများ အချို့သော IDE တွင် မည်သည့်နည်းပညာကိုမဆို အသုံးပြုသည်ဖြစ်စေ နောက်ခံဗဟုသုတအနည်းငယ်ရှိရန် သို့မဟုတ် အနည်းဆုံး ၎င်းသည် ဘာအတွက်ကြောင့်ဖြစ်သည်ကို သိထားသင့်သည်။ ယေဘုယျအားဖြင့် XML ကို functional အဆင့်တွင် လေ့လာရန် မခက်ခဲပါ။

XML ဖိုင်ကို ဖတ်နိုင်သောဖိုင်သို့ မည်သို့ပြောင်းရမည်နည်း။

ဤအပိုင်းတွင် လွယ်ကူသော အဆင့် ၃ ဆင့်ဖြင့် XML ကို စာသားသို့ ပြောင်းနည်းကို ဖော်ပြထားသည်-

  1. XML ကိုဖွင့်ပါ။ ဤပထမအဆင့်တွင်၊ ကွန်ပြူတာရှိ သင်၏မူလဘရောက်ဆာမှတစ်ဆင့် ၎င်းကိုဖွင့်ရန် သင်၏ XML ဖိုင်ကို နှစ်ချက်နှိပ်ပါ။ …
  2. XML ကို ပရင့်ထုတ်ပါ။ ဤ XML ဖိုင်ကိုဖွင့်ပြီးပါက ၎င်းကို loading အတွက်အသုံးပြုသည့်ဘရောက်ဆာရှိ “Print” option ကို နောက်တစ်ကြိမ်နှိပ်သင့်သည်။ …
  3. XML ကို Text သို့ ပြောင်းပါ။

ဥပမာ XML ဆိုတာ ဘာလဲ။

XML သည် HTML နှင့် အလွန်ဆင်တူသော ဘာသာစကားတစ်ခုဖြစ်သည်။ … XML သည် မက်တာဘာသာစကားဖြစ်သည်- အခြားဘာသာစကားများကို ဖန်တီးရန် သို့မဟုတ် သတ်မှတ်ရန် ခွင့်ပြုသည့် ဘာသာစကားတစ်ခုဖြစ်သည်။ ဥပမာအားဖြင့်၊ XML ဖြင့် ကျွန်ုပ်တို့သည် RSS၊ MathML (သင်္ချာဆိုင်ရာ အမှတ်အသားဘာသာစကား) နှင့် XSLT ကဲ့သို့သော ကိရိယာများပင် ကဲ့သို့သော အခြားဘာသာစကားများကို ဖန်တီးနိုင်သည်။

XML ကို ယနေ့ အသုံးပြုနေပါသလား။

XML သည် ယနေ့တိုင် အသက်ရှင်ဆဲဖြစ်ပြီး အဓိကအားဖြင့် ၎င်းသည် ပလပ်ဖောင်းကို ဘာသာမဲ့ဖြစ်သောကြောင့်ဖြစ်သည်။ ၎င်းသည် ယူနီကုဒ်ကို ပံ့ပိုးထားပြီး ဒေတာတင်ပြမှုလုပ်ငန်းအသွားအလာ၏ တစ်စိတ်တစ်ပိုင်းအဖြစ် မကြာခဏ အသုံးပြုလေ့ရှိသည်။

Android မှာ ဘယ်အပြင်အဆင်က အကောင်းဆုံးလဲ။

အဲဒီအစား FrameLayout၊ RelativeLayout သို့မဟုတ် စိတ်ကြိုက် အပြင်အဆင်ကို သုံးပါ။

အဆိုပါ အပြင်အဆင်များသည် မတူညီသော မျက်နှာပြင်အရွယ်အစားများနှင့် လိုက်လျောညီထွေရှိမည်ဖြစ်ပြီး AbsoluteLayout တွင် ရှိမည်မဟုတ်ပါ။ အခြား layout အားလုံးထက် LinearLayout အတွက် အမြဲသွားနေပါတယ်။

Android တွင် layout အမျိုးအစားများကား အဘယ်နည်း။

Android အက်ပ်ကို ဒီဇိုင်းဆွဲရာမှာ အဓိက Layout အမျိုးအစားတွေက ဘာတွေလဲဆိုတာ ကြည့်လိုက်ရအောင်။

  • Layout ဆိုတာ ဘာလဲ ?
  • လက်ကွက်ဖွဲ့စည်းပုံ။
  • Linear Layout
  • နှိုင်းရလက်ကွက်။
  • စားပွဲအပြင်အဆင်။
  • Grid View
  • တဘ်လက်ကွက်။
  • စာရင်းကြည့်ရှုခြင်း။

၁ အာпр ၂၀၂၁ ခုနှစ်။

Android တွင် အပြင်အဆင်များကို မည်သို့ထားရှိသနည်း။

အပြင်အဆင်ကို နည်းလမ်းနှစ်မျိုးဖြင့် ကြေညာနိုင်သည်- XML ​​တွင် UI အစိတ်အပိုင်းများကို ကြေငြာပါ။ Android သည် ဝစ်ဂျက်များနှင့် အပြင်အဆင်များကဲ့သို့သော View အတန်းများနှင့် အတန်းခွဲများနှင့် ကိုက်ညီသော ရိုးရှင်းသော XML ဝေါဟာရကို ပံ့ပိုးပေးပါသည်။ သင်၏ XML အပြင်အဆင်ကို ဆွဲယူ၍ ချပေးသည့် မျက်နှာပြင်ကို အသုံးပြု၍ Android Studio ၏ Layout Editor ကိုလည်း အသုံးပြုနိုင်သည်။

ဒီပို့စ်ကိုကြိုက်လား။ ကျေးဇူးပြု၍ သင်၏မိတ်ဆွေများကိုမျှဝေပါ။
OS ယနေ့